Californian Fuchsia Zauschneria californica Glasnevin
  • £9.99

Zauschneria californica 'Glasnevin', also known as the Californian fuchsia, is an award-winning perennial bursting with vibrant red trumpet blooms. Its fiery flowers are favoured by hummingbirds in its native North America, giving rise to its other, rather delightful name of the hummingbird trumpet flower. Thriving in sun baked, nutrient poor soil, it's perfectly adapted to our increasingly dry summers with its food storing roots and thin silvery leaves - ideal for conserving food and water. Highly desirable for the autumn garden, and to bring colour to gravel gardens, Zauschneria will light up your pots and borders with colour and being drought tolerant when established it's low maintenance and easy to grow too! Fully deserving its coveted RHS Award of Garden Merit, you can be sure that this is a proven garden performer, guaranteed to be suitable for UK gardeners at every level of experience. You can therefore plant this in the garden with confidence, for stunning displays for many years to come. Supplied as 6 plug plants ready for potting up and growing on before planting out in the garden, this compact, clump-forming perennial reaches just 30cm (12in) high x 60cm (24in) wide.

Harlequin Living Willow Sculpture
  • £29.99

We were blown away when we saw these simply beautiful Living Willow sculptures - combining fabulous designs with easy care gardening, for amazing garden impact. Superb as a garden feature plant, each sculpture is hand-made, so varies slightly form pot to pot, from living, but dormant Willow stems, skilfully woven into stunning designs. Once planted inot the pot, they begin to root away, and then in Spring produce a crown of leaves on top. The overall effect of a stunning trunk effect, and leaves on top creates a magical look. Grow them on into larger pots, or plant direct into the ground, over a number of years, the individual stems gradually grow into each other and merge into one exotic lattice trunk. They are reasonably straight forward to care for over rmany years. Cut back top growth hard in early Spring, then try to shape 2 or 3 times in Summer.  Remove any leaves that occasionally appear on the bare stems. NB: Heights quoted are height of stems above pot, before leaves grow. When the willow is first planted you can't water it enough! Keep well watered until it has formed a good clump of root.

Long season cropping Rhubarb Livingstone
  • £3.99

Everyone loves fresh Rhubarb in their garden, and it's one of the easiest things to grow on a kitchen garden. But, it has one drawback - it throws masses of lovely succulent new stems in Spring for a Month, then that's pretty much it...... feast and famine. That's because all Rhubarb plants till now go dormant in Summer. Now, we are pleased to introduce a very special British bred variety called 'Livingstone' - which is a day-neutral variety so eliminates this Summer dormancy - this means it produces stems in Spring, but then keeps on going into Summer with bigger crops again in Autumn - giving a bountiful supply for 6 Months or more. The flavour is good and sweet, and is a very easy to grow and long lasting plant - the crown will slowly expand over many years producing more and more 'stocks' for you to harvest. Vinca minor Alba
  • £9.99

Periwinkles are invaluable garden perennials for providing colourful groundcover, especially in shady areas, with low growing stems dotted with star shaped flowers. Vinca minor 'Alba' forms a mat glossy, oval evergreen leaves on long prostrate stems that bear lovely, pure white flowers with broad petals from March until September. Although quick to form weed-suppressing groundcover, 'Alba' is not as vigorous as its Vinca major relatives, so it won't get out of control or become invasive. It will grow almost anywhere, from full sun to the shadiest places beneath trees. The stems will easily root where they touch the ground as the plant spreads, perfect for brightening dull areas where little else will thrive, and ideal for keeping weeds under control. Easy to grow, extremely hardy and very low maintenance, requiring just an occasional trim to help to keep the foliage dense, 'Alba' is the perfect Periwinkle. It makes excellent edging for a pond, and looks great trailing out of hanging baskets and patio pots too! Supplied as an established plant in a 9cm pot, ready to plant straight, growing to a height of 25cm (10in) and spreading to 1.5m (5ft).
